Are Hot Baths Bad For Ms. Exactly like it sounds, the hot bath test involved placing a patient suspected of having ms in a hot bath to see if his or her symptoms worsened with heat. Increased activity, hot weather, hot baths and showers, saunas, and hot tubs are all sources of heat that can cause issues for someone living with ms.
